[docs] class SpinBox(QtWidgets.QAbstractSpinBox): """ **Bases:** QtWidgets.QAbstractSpinBox Extension of QSpinBox widget for selection of a numerical value. Adds many extra features: * SI prefix notation (eg, automatically display "300 mV" instead of "0.003 V") * Float values with linear and decimal stepping (1-9, 10-90, 100-900, etc.) * Option for unbounded values * Delayed signals (allows multiple rapid changes with only one change signal) * Customizable text formatting ============================= ============================================== **Signals:** valueChanged(value) Same as QSpinBox; emitted every time the value has changed. sigValueChanged(self) Emitted when value has changed, but also combines multiple rapid changes into one signal (eg, when rolling the mouse wheel). sigValueChanging(self, value) Emitted immediately for all value changes. ============================= ============================================== """ ## There's a PyQt bug that leaks a reference to the ## QLineEdit returned from QAbstractSpinBox.lineEdit() ## This makes it possible to crash the entire program ## by making accesses to the LineEdit after the spinBox has been deleted. ## I have no idea how to get around this.. valueChanged = QtCore.Signal(object) # (value) for compatibility with QSpinBox sigValueChanged = QtCore.Signal(object) # (self) sigValueChanging = QtCore.Signal(object, object) # (self, value) sent immediately; no delay.

[docs] def setOpts(self, **opts): """Set options affecting the behavior of the SpinBox. ============== ======================================================================== **Arguments:** bounds (min,max) Minimum and maximum values allowed in the SpinBox. Either may be None to leave the value unbounded. By default, values are unbounded. suffix (str) suffix (units) to display after the numerical value. By default, suffix is an empty str. siPrefix (bool) If True, then an SI prefix is automatically prepended to the units and the value is scaled accordingly. For example, if value=0.003 and suffix='V', then the SpinBox will display "300 mV" (but a call to SpinBox.value will still return 0.003). In case the value represents a dimensionless quantity that might span many orders of magnitude, such as a Reynolds number, an SI prefix is allowed with no suffix. Default is False. prefix (str) String to be prepended to the spin box value. Default is an empty string. scaleAtZero (float) If siPrefix is also True, this option then sets the default SI prefix that a value of 0 will have applied (and thus the default scale of the first number the user types in after the SpinBox has been zeroed out). step (float) The size of a single step. This is used when clicking the up/ down arrows, when rolling the mouse wheel, or when pressing keyboard arrows while the widget has keyboard focus. Note that the interpretation of this value is different when specifying the 'dec' argument. If 'int' is True, 'step' is rounded to the nearest integer. Default is 0.01 if 'int' is False and 1 otherwise. dec (bool) If True, then the step value will be adjusted to match the current size of the variable (for example, a value of 15 might step in increments of 1 whereas a value of 1500 would step in increments of 100). In this case, the 'step' argument is interpreted *relative* to the current value. The most common 'step' values when dec=True are 0.1, 0.2, 0.5, and 1.0. Default is False. minStep (float) When dec=True, this specifies the minimum allowable step size. int (bool) If True, the value is forced to integer type. If True, 'step' is rounded to the nearest integer or defaults to 1. Default is False finite (bool) When False and int=False, infinite values (nan, inf, -inf) are permitted. Default is True. wrapping (bool) If True and both bounds are not None, spin box has circular behavior. decimals (int) Number of decimal values to display. Default is 6. format (str) Formatting string used to generate the text shown. Formatting is done with ``str.format()`` and makes use of several arguments: * *value* - the unscaled value of the spin box * *prefix* - the prefix string * *prefixGap* - a single space if a prefix is present, or an empty string otherwise * *suffix* - the suffix string * *scaledValue* - the scaled value to use when an SI prefix is present * *siPrefix* - the SI prefix string (if any), or an empty string if this feature has been disabled * *suffixGap* - a single space if a suffix is present, or an empty string otherwise. regex (str or RegexObject) Regular expression used to parse the spinbox text. May contain the following group names: * *number* - matches the numerical portion of the string (mandatory) * *siPrefix* - matches the SI prefix string * *suffix* - matches the suffix string Default is defined in ``pyqtgraph.functions.FLOAT_REGEX``. evalFunc (callable) Fucntion that converts a numerical string to a number, preferrably a Decimal instance. This function handles only the numerical of the text; it does not have access to the suffix or SI prefix. compactHeight (bool) if True, then set the maximum height of the spinbox based on the height of its font. This allows more compact packing on platforms with excessive widget decoration. Default is True. ============== ======================================================================== """ #print opts for k,v in opts.items(): if k == 'bounds': self.setMinimum(v[0], update=False) self.setMaximum(v[1], update=False) elif k == 'min': self.setMinimum(v, update=False) elif k == 'max': self.setMaximum(v, update=False) elif k in ['step', 'minStep']: self.opts[k] = decimal.Decimal(str(v)) elif k == 'value': pass ## don't set value until bounds have been set elif k == 'format': self.opts[k] = str(v) elif k == 'regex' and isinstance(v, str): self.opts[k] = re.compile(v) elif k in self.opts: self.opts[k] = v else: raise TypeError("Invalid keyword argument '%s'." % k) if 'value' in opts: self.setValue(opts['value']) ## If bounds have changed, update value to match if 'bounds' in opts and 'value' not in opts: self.setValue() ## sanity checks: if self.opts['int']: self.opts['step'] = round(self.opts.get('step', 1)) if 'minStep' in opts: step = opts['minStep'] if int(step) != step: raise Exception('Integer SpinBox must have integer minStep size.') else: ms = int(self.opts.get('minStep', 1)) if ms < 1: ms = 1 self.opts['minStep'] = ms if 'format' not in opts: self.opts['format'] = "{prefix}{prefixGap}{value:d}{suffixGap}{suffix}" if self.opts['dec']: if self.opts.get('minStep') is None: self.opts['minStep'] = self.opts['step'] if 'delay' in opts: self.proxy.setDelay(opts['delay']) self.updateText()
